> > > Note that there will be two documentation policies: one for Debian
> > > documantation itself and one for the DDP.
> > 
> > Where's the difference!?
> 
> Well, if I understand things correctly (Christian S.: please correct
> me if I'm wrong), the first one is about which types of documentation
> we have within Debian, where they should be stored, the preferred
> formats, etc., in other words everything about the documentation
> coming with the packages.  The other one is about how we within the
> DDP handle uploads, style guide, etc., in other words everything
> specific for the documentation written within DDP. 

As there are IMHO no conflicts I propose to put both aspects into one
document to ease maintainance.
